2640A/2645A Combined Specifications
Characteristic
2640A
Slow - 6 readings per second
Medium - 45 readings per second (60 Hz)
Fast - 143 readings per second
(20 configured channels)
2645A
Slow - 54 readings per second (60 Hz)
Medium - 200 readings per second
Fast - 1000 readings per second
(20 configured channels)
Fast single Channel - 400 readings per second
= (Fast Accuracy + Slow Accuracy)/2
If the instrument was fully warmed-up at the
time drift correction was disabled, i.e. turned-
on at least 1 hour earlier; 1/10 of the 90 day
specification per C change in ambient
temperature from the temperature when drift
correction was disabled.
If the instrument was NOT fully warmed-up at
the time drift correction was disabled; Add an
error equal to the 90 day specification for
instrument warm-up + 1/10 of the 90 day
specification per C change in ambient
temperature from the temperature when drift
correction was disabled.
